@implementation NSSpeechRecognizer
/**
* If the remote end exits before freeing the GSSpeechRecognizer then we need
* to send it a -release message to make sure it dies.
*/
+ (void)connectionDied: (NSNotification*)aNotification
{
NSEnumerator *e = [[[aNotification object] localObjects] objectEnumerator];
NSObject *o = nil;
for (o = [e nextObject] ; nil != o ; o = [e nextObject])
{
if ([o isKindOfClass: self])
{
[o release];
}
}
}
+ (void) initialize
{
if (self == [NSSpeechRecognizer class])
{
if (nil == _speechRecognitionServer)
{
NSWorkspace *ws = [NSWorkspace sharedWorkspace];
[ws launchApplication: SPEECH_RECOGNITION_SERVER
showIcon: NO
autolaunch: NO];
}
[[NSNotificationCenter defaultCenter]
addObserver: self
selector: @selector(connectionDied:)
name: NSConnectionDidDieNotification
object: nil];
}
}
- (void) processNotification: (NSNotification *)note
{
NSString *word = (NSString *)[note object];
word = [word lowercaseString];
FOR_IN(NSString*, obj, _commands)
{
if ([[obj lowercaseString] isEqualToString: word])
{
[_delegate speechRecognizer: self
didRecognizeCommand: word];
}
}
END_FOR_IN(_commands);
}
// Initialize
- (instancetype) init
{
self = [super init];
if (self != nil)
{
[[NSDistributedNotificationCenter defaultCenter]
addObserver: self
selector: @selector(processNotification:)
name: GSSpeechRecognizerDidRecognizeWordNotification
object: nil];
if (nil == _speechRecognitionServer && !_serverLaunchTested)
{
unsigned int i = 0;
// Wait for up to five seconds for the server to launch, then give up.
for (i=0 ; i < 50 ; i++)
{
_speechRecognitionServer = [NSConnection
rootProxyForConnectionWithRegisteredName: SPEECH_RECOGNITION_SERVER
host: nil];
RETAIN(_speechRecognitionServer);
if (nil != _speechRecognitionServer)
{
NSLog(@"Server found!!!");
clients++;
break;
}
[NSThread sleepForTimeInterval: 0.1];
}
// Set a flag so we don't bother waiting for the speech recognition server to
// launch the next time if it didn't work this time.
_serverLaunchTested = YES;
}
}
return self;
}
